It's 11:47pm on a Sunday. Someone has a toothache, broken glasses or a question about your price. Your business is asleep; so is your competition. The difference is what happens to that message: it goes cold until Monday (and maybe gets lost), or it gets an answer on the spot.

What it does do

  • Answers with YOUR information — real hours, prices and services — the ones you gave it, not the internet's generic ones.

  • Proposes appointments inside your diary — without touching your rest or inventing slots.

  • Replies in Spanish, Catalan or English — depending on who writes — the neighbour and the tourist, both well served.

  • Leaves you the summary on WhatsApp — in the morning you scan a list, you don't wrestle with an inbox.

The repeated questions —are you open Saturdays, where do I park, how much is a cleaning— are a huge share of any local business's messages. Having a machine resolve them instantly isn't science fiction: it's the most boring and most profitable use case of today's AI.

What it should never do

the workshop rules

  1. Answers only what you have confirmed — your real catalogue — no more, no less.

  2. Clearly flags when something leaves its ground — instead of covering it up or improvising.

  3. Passes you the baton — and you decide. No "revolutionary artificial intelligence" theatre: a night-shift employee that does three things well and doesn't touch the rest.
